Product Marketing Manager, iPhone

3+ years Product Management experience with at least one entire product development cycle from concept to introduction. Experience with consumer electronics and imaging technologies for photography or video strongly preferred.

Technical track record working closely with engineering/technical teams from an in-bound marketing perspective including during early research and development.

Experience and ability to synthesize technologies into product communication for broad audience including customers, media, analysts, photographers, filmmakers, and industry experts.

Requires best-in-class oral and written communication skills, as well as demonstrated success as a product spokesperson on a national or global level.

Previous experience with press and media.

Experience working closely with cross-functional teams to define product strategy and roadmap, craft positioning, and define marketing activities.

Requires international and domestic travel.

DescriptionWork with a global cross-functional team to define iPhone hardware and software features. Partner with engineering, industrial design, operations, finance, public relations, and marketing communications through the complete product development cycle. Understand your product technologies several layers deep and be able to clearly communicate them with knowledgable insight. Evaluate new technologies and make recommendations to pursue in future products. Collect global customer and partner requirements for future product development. Manage trade-offs involving features, schedule, cost, pricing, line positioning, and lifecycle management. Discern new product development opportunities while contributing to the development of the overall iPhone product line strategy. Possess expert knowledge of competitive and 3rd party products. Make pricing and forecasting recommendations to management and cross-functional teams. Communicate and position the product in relation to other products and the competition. Define product positioning and key product messages. Work with marketing communications and PR on the development of product launch activities, press releases, and marketing materials. Travel the world as the ambassador for your product attending trade shows, customer visits, and press briefings. Closely follow emerging technology, consumer, and societal trends and make recommendations for how products will leverage or fit into those emerging trends.Education & ExperienceBS/BA degree. Background or education in photography or film a plus.Additional Requirements
